Enhancing Oncology Care: Florida Cancer Specialists at NCODA Spring Forum



Florida Cancer Specialists & Research Institute, LLC (FCS) is making significant strides in the realm of oncology care by sharing their expertise at the NCODA 2025 International Spring Forum in Denver, a premier event that focuses on improving patient-centered care in cancer treatment. With their extensive background in pharmacy services integrated within oncology, FCS is positioned as a leader in the field, driving positive outcomes for patients through effective medication management and operational excellence.

During the forum, FCS leaders are set to present their insights on specialty pharmacy operations, which encompasses patient navigation, dispensing best practices, and the crucial role these elements play in enhancing patient experiences. Dr. Lucio N. Gordan, President and Managing Physician of FCS, emphasized the importance of these discussions, stating, “We welcome this opportunity to join our clinical and industry colleagues and share top-tier knowledge that is advancing patient-centered cancer treatment throughout the entire care continuum.” Notably, Dr. Gordan's involvement extends to his recent appointment to NCODA's board of directors, highlighting FCS's commitment to leading advancements in cancer care.

FCS's innovative pharmacy, Rx To Go, has become a vital component of their patient care model, providing personalized support, timely medication access, and educational resources for effective drug usage. The pharmacy is focused on delivering efficient and convenient home delivery of oral oncolytic medications, which represent a growing segment of cancer treatment protocols. As noted by Paul Chadwick, Chief Value & Procurement Officer at FCS, “Through collaborative integration, we are positively enhancing the patient experience and contributing to positive clinical outcomes.” This approach underscores FCS's dedication to not only meeting patient needs but exceeding them through comprehensive care services.

At the NCODA Spring Forum, several workshops and discussions are planned. Key FCS representatives, including Chris Elder, PharmD, BCOP, and Danielle Brown, MBA, BSN, RN, OCN, will guide discussions around crucial topics such as enhancing patient navigation and practical strategies for transforming oncology care. These sessions are designed to focus on real-world applications and evidence-based practices, aimed at improving overall patient outcomes in oncology settings.

FCS also champions the integration of clinical research within their practices, emphasizing access to clinical trials, which is instrumental in pioneering the availability of breakthrough cancer therapies. As one of the foremost entities for clinical research in Florida, FCS ensures that patients can participate in trials that often serve as an initial testing ground for emerging cancer medications before they receive FDA approval. This dedication to research reflects their commitment to delivering state-of-the-art cancer treatments to their patients.
